A parallel plate capacitor with air between the plates has a capacitance of 9 pF . The separation between the plates is d . The space between the plates is now filled with two dielectrics constant K 1 = 3 and thickness d 3 while the other one has dielectric constant K 2 = 6 and thickness 2 d 3 . Capacitance of the capacitor is now
Options
- A1 . 8   pF
- B45   pF
- C40 . 5   pF
- D20 . 25   pF
Correct answer
C. 40 . 5   pF
